Transaction 0b4bf27d140f0c2363939e989cf2ef601e9248144f1065afd728a7b0fee821f8

2 Input
2 Outputs
  • 0b4bf27d140f0c2363939e989cf2ef601e9248144f1065afd728a7b0fee821f8:0
  • value  28618480
    address  34wL4FibJAhHU15if9ZVZzVEpAGcZcCRhK
  • 0b4bf27d140f0c2363939e989cf2ef601e9248144f1065afd728a7b0fee821f8:1
  • value  3186558287
    address  3PbgXaBfL3wm2toEf1xJweNiaLaPSv4bMG